The Importance of Measuring the Effectiveness of Public Information Communications

Public information communications are essential for organizations to effectively connect with their stakeholders and the public. However, it is important to measure the effectiveness of these communications to ensure that they are reaching their intended audience and achieving their desired outcomes.

One way to measure the effectiveness of public information communications is to conduct a baseline measurement of the current level of public awareness. This can be done by surveying a sample of the target population to gauge their knowledge of the issue or issue at hand. Once you have a baseline measurement, you can then develop a plan to raise public awareness. This plan should be based on the results of the baseline measurement and should take into account the specific needs of your target audience.

After the plan has been implemented, it is important to conduct a follow-up survey to assess the effectiveness of the communications. This survey should be identical to the baseline measurement so that you can directly compare the results. By comparing the results of the two surveys, you can see if the plan was successful in raising public awareness and achieving its desired outcomes.

There are many benefits to measuring the effectiveness of public information communications. First, it can help you to identify what is working and what is not. This information can then be used to improve your communications strategy and ensure that you are getting the most out of your efforts. Second, measuring the effectiveness of your communications can help you to demonstrate the value of your work to your stakeholders. This can be important for securing funding and support for your initiatives. Finally, measuring the effectiveness of your communications can help you to improve your reputation and credibility. By showing that you are committed to communicating effectively, you can build trust with your stakeholders and the public.

Here are some additional tips for measuring the effectiveness of public information communications:

  • Be clear about your objectives. What do you want to achieve with your communications?
  • Choose the right metrics. The metrics you choose should be relevant to your objectives and should be measurable.
  • Collect data from a variety of sources. This will give you a more complete picture of the effectiveness of your communications.
  • Analyze the data carefully. Look for patterns and trends that can help you to improve your communications.
  • Use the data to make changes to your communications strategy. Don't be afraid to experiment and try new things.
